June 2nd, 2008, Dallas, TX -- eMazing Gaming, LLC, is proud to announce the return of our popular DotA tournament as the 2008 Dust-Off Fire & Ice Series. For 2008, Fire & Ice has evolved into a series of qualifiers that lead up to a Grand Final in Chicago, IL with over $12,500 in cash and prizes. The total prizes purse for the series will be over $25,000.
The series will begin in July and run through December. The tournament series will feature stops at Netolic LAN center in Annadale, VA; Gamers Universe in San Diego, CA; and conclude once again at Ignite Network in Chicago, IL. Beginning in September an online qualifier will be hosted through the eMazing Gamers Zone. For more details or to register for the event please visit the event website at http://dota.emgaming.com .
